study guides for every class

that actually explain what's on your next test

Data preprocessing

from class:

Wireless Sensor Networks

Definition

Data preprocessing is the technique of cleaning and transforming raw data into a format suitable for analysis, particularly in the context of machine learning. It involves various steps like data cleaning, normalization, and feature selection to improve the quality of data and ensure that machine learning algorithms can effectively learn from it. Proper data preprocessing is crucial for enhancing the performance and accuracy of models in wireless sensor networks.

congrats on reading the definition of data preprocessing. now let's actually learn it.

ok, let's learn stuff

5 Must Know Facts For Your Next Test

  1. Data preprocessing can significantly impact the results of machine learning models, as clean and well-structured data leads to more reliable predictions.
  2. In wireless sensor networks, data from various sensors may contain noise and outliers, making data preprocessing essential for effective analysis.
  3. Techniques like imputation can be used during data preprocessing to handle missing values and maintain dataset integrity.
  4. Preprocessing often includes transforming categorical data into numerical format to make it usable for machine learning algorithms.
  5. Automated tools and libraries are available to streamline the data preprocessing process, but understanding the underlying principles is crucial for effective implementation.

Review Questions

  • How does data preprocessing influence the effectiveness of machine learning models in wireless sensor networks?
    • Data preprocessing directly influences the effectiveness of machine learning models by ensuring that the input data is clean, consistent, and relevant. In wireless sensor networks, raw data often contains noise or outliers that can skew results. By applying techniques like data cleaning and normalization, analysts can enhance the quality of input data, leading to better training outcomes and more accurate predictions. This ultimately improves decision-making processes based on sensor data.
  • Discuss the key steps involved in data preprocessing and their relevance to improving model accuracy.
    • Key steps in data preprocessing include data cleaning, normalization, and feature selection. Data cleaning addresses inconsistencies and removes irrelevant or incorrect entries, while normalization ensures that all features contribute equally by scaling them to a standard range. Feature selection further enhances model accuracy by focusing on the most relevant variables. Each step plays a vital role in preparing high-quality input for machine learning models, which can lead to improved performance.
  • Evaluate the impact of effective data preprocessing on the overall performance of machine learning applications in real-time sensor environments.
    • Effective data preprocessing has a profound impact on the performance of machine learning applications in real-time sensor environments. It allows for accurate interpretation of sensor data by mitigating issues related to noise, missing values, and inconsistencies. By ensuring that only relevant features are used and that data is in an optimal format, machine learning models can operate more efficiently and yield precise predictions. This reliability is crucial for applications such as environmental monitoring or health care, where decisions based on sensor data can have significant consequences.
© 2024 Fiveable Inc. All rights reserved.
AP® and SAT® are trademarks registered by the College Board, which is not affiliated with, and does not endorse this website.